A recent development has sparked curiosity and raised questions about the relationship between the US and India, specifically regarding trade and energy dynamics. The spotlight is on a conversation between President Donald Trump and Prime Minister Narendra Modi, and the potential implications for both nations.
Trump, in a warm and friendly tone, described Modi as "a great person" and "a great friend," extending his best wishes to the people of India. He revealed that their discussion primarily focused on trade matters. But here's where it gets controversial: Trump's claim that Modi assured him India would stop buying Russian oil has been met with skepticism and denial from the Indian side.
"I spoke with Prime Minister Modi, and he said he's not going to be doing the Russian oil thing," Trump stated aboard Air Force One. However, India has consistently maintained that its energy purchases are market-driven and necessary for national security, not influenced by geopolitical alignments.
This statement by Trump comes amidst ongoing trade negotiations between India and the US, with Trump imposing 50% tariffs on Indian imports, including a 25% duty as a penalty for India's oil trade with Russia. India has defended its right to secure affordable energy for its population, stating that its purchases are driven by market forces and security needs.
